Other

Sawn or sliced tropical wood, other species

PARTNER GOVERNMENT AGENCY CLEARANCE

HSN 4407 29 00 (sawn or sliced wood of other tropical species) is subject to mandatory Phyto-Sanitary Certificate clearance administered by the Directorate General of Foreign Trade (DGFT) under the ITC (HS) import policy for wood products. The Phyto-Sanitary Certificate (document code 851000) must be uploaded in e-Sanchit before customs out-of-charge is granted.

Compliance steps
  1. 1
    Obtain a Phyto-Sanitary Certificate (PSC) from the competent plant-protection authority of the exporting country before shipment. Upload the PSC in e-Sanchit under document code 851000 at the bill-of-entry stage; the proper officer will verify upload before granting out-of-charge.
    CCR mandatory document requirement · document code 851000 · e-Sanchit OOC verification requirement
  2. 2
    File the bill of entry and confirm that the e-Sanchit document reference for the Phyto-Sanitary Certificate is correctly linked. Consignments where the PSC has not been routed through the PGA and uploaded will be detained pending verification by the proper officer.
    CCR PGA-facilitated-bill verification requirement · document code 851000
A word of counsel

The most common error on this tariff line is shipping the consignment before the Phyto-Sanitary Certificate is issued and uploaded, on the assumption that it can be submitted after arrival. The customs proper officer is required to verify the PSC upload in e-Sanchit before out-of-charge regardless of whether the bill was PGA-facilitated; a missing or mismatched document code 851000 results in consignment detention, accruing demurrage and ground rent until the document is regularised.

Frequently asked
Does HSN 4407 29 00 require BIS certification?
No. No BIS Quality Control Order covers sawn or sliced wood of this product family. The operative requirement is a Phyto-Sanitary Certificate under the ITC (HS) import policy for Chapter 44, administered by DGFT, with e-Sanchit upload mandatory before customs out-of-charge.
What is document code 851000 and who must upload it in e-Sanchit?
Document code 851000 is the Phyto-Sanitary Certificate issued by the plant-protection authority of the exporting country; the importer or their customs broker must upload it in e-Sanchit at the bill-of-entry stage before the proper officer can grant out-of-charge.
Does the PSC requirement apply even when the bill of entry is not routed through the PGA for an NOC?
Yes. The CCR requires the proper officer to verify PSC upload (document code 851000) in e-Sanchit for all bills, including PGA-facilitated bills not routed through the PGA for an NOC, before granting out-of-charge.
